Remote, text-based counselling is growing in appeal in the UK. The medical professional app Babylon offers therapy to 150,000 active users, while PlusGuidance, an online counselling service, has 10,000 users. The US-based service BetterHelp likewise has 150,000 signed up UK users (though not all are active). Talkspace, another online treatment platform, reports it has 500,000 signed up users worldwide, with most in the United States.

Marc Bush, primary policy consultant at Young Minds, stated that while online counselling services are valuable, “they shouldn’t replace in person treatment with a qualified professional. If a young adult is struggling, we would encourage them to speak with their GP in the very first circumstances, or to get in touch with a recognized service like The Mix, Childline or the Samaritans.”.

The company explains BetterHelp as the “largest online counseling platform worldwide,” geared toward assisting people dealing with problems “such as stress, stress and anxiety, relationships, parenting, anxiety, addictions, eating, sleeping, trauma, anger, family conflicts, LGBT matters, sorrow, religious beliefs [or] self esteem.” The company’s frequently asked question area on its website plainly states BetterHelp’s app and counselors shouldn’t be utilized for individuals handling a serious mental illness (schizophrenia, bipolar affective disorder) or for people considering self-harm. Rather, the app prides itself on having actually certified therapists and mental health professionals available to assist individuals through text, phone call or video chat.
